== Navajo ==
=== Etymology ===
ʼa- (“away”) + -y- (3rd person object prefix) + -hi- (seriative) + ∅- (3rd person subject prefix) + -∅- (classifier) + -nííł (imperfective stem of the root -NIL, “to handle several objects”). This verb is the seriative of iinííł.
=== Verb ===
ayiinííł
he/she is putting, carrying, taking, or tossing them away out of sight on after another (plural relatively large objects)
(with atah naaltsoos): to vote, participate in an election, cast a ballot
(with naaltsoos -á): to vote for
(with dah): he/she is tossing plural objects down from a height on after the other; he/she is unloading one plural quantity after another
